CVE-2001-0310 describes a vulnerability in the 'sort' utility in FreeBSD 4.1.1 and earlier, where predictable temporary file names and improper handling of existing temporary files can lead to the 'sort' process crashing. This local vulnerability has a low severity CVSS score of 2.1, indicating a low impact on availability with no confidentiality or integrity concerns. There is no evidence of active exploitation, public exploit code (Metasploit, Nuclei, ExploitDB), or community discussion surrounding this CVE.
